Freigeben über


event::wait-Methode

Wartet, bis das Ereignis signalisiert wird.

_CRTIMP size_t wait(
   unsigned int _Timeout = COOPERATIVE_TIMEOUT_INFINITE
);

Parameter

  • _Timeout
    Gibt die Wartezeit in Millisekunden bis zum Timeout an. Der Wert COOPERATIVE_TIMEOUT_INFINITE gibt an, dass kein Timeout besteht.

Rückgabewert

Wenn der Wartevorgang zufrieden gestellt wurde, wird der Wert 0 zurückgegeben. Andernfalls gibt der Wert COOPERATIVE_WAIT_TIMEOUT an, dass das Timeout für den Wartevorgang abgelaufen ist, ohne dass das Ereignis signalisiert wurde.

Anforderungen

Header: concrt.h

Namespace: Concurrency

Siehe auch

Referenz

event-Klasse (Concurrency Runtime)

event::set-Methode

Weitere Ressourcen

COOPERATIVE_TIMEOUT_INFINITE-Konstante

COOPERATIVE_WAIT_TIMEOUT-Konstante